Hey thanks, I appreciate the compliments. And I tend to focus on the vintage stuff since it seems to be a lot sturdier and more modifiable than what is out there now (for the most part). Anyways, this one is PPC style, that's what I was going for. It's actually been upgraded with a custom steel cylinder made by JezX since the photos (as well as another barrel from JezX that is longer with better rifling). Regardless, the grey ones I had to track down from a couple of places since they are sort of rare. MrMarvin here on the forum had a couple, and I got two from Ebay. If you look around you can find them.

Umarex Brodax fitted with .177 rifled barrel with magazine adapted to take pellets. Trigger surfaces have been smoothed and shaped, which brings the action very close to that of a 38T which is the standard I go by. Doesn't break like glass, but close.

This is in the process of being converted to a Deckard PDK Blaster, and will be using 3D printed parts.
